Will Trump’s bunker buster bombs punch through Iran’s Pickaxe Mountain?
Spread the love Conventional bombs explode on or near a target surface, with the explosion and fragments, e.g. shrapnel, rendering the bomb’s damage. But when a target is buried deep under a mountain, the soil and rock mass surrounding it can absorb enough of the blast’s energy to keep the target from being damaged too much.
